CCRN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

149 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cross Country Healthcare (CCRN)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$443M — up 19% from $372M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 21 funds closed out of CCRN and 19 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 46 trimmed existing stakes and 53 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$13.2M. The largest seller was Acadian Asset Management, cutting an estimated $6.07M.
